Zhantemir Baymukhamedov

Your project has entered our festival. What is your project about?
This is short film based on real story that I've red in newspaper about 35 years ago. Story norrates about relationship between rat and human. Main hero appeared in diificult life situation after long period of time he spend in prison. And the rat was the only creature who helped him.

Why did you decide to become a filmmaker?

Since childhood, I dreamed of being an actor, but they didn't take me to the cinema. Then I decided to make films myself and act in films myself. this is my 2nd film, but I didn't shoot here. I was also influenced by the films Pulp Fiction and Trainspotting

What do you consider your greatest achievement in your career?
I was a star of the 90s in the Republic of Kazakhstan, being a musician and a TV and radio host, and in the cinema, in which I take my first steps, a great achievement is the fact that my film The Rat won 6 Grand Prix at international festivals around the world.

Have you already visited any of the prestigious film festivals?
Unfortunately, I have not yet participated in the Cannes Film Festival, but at the film festivals in Malta, Macau, San Paolo, Moscow and other festivals, my film won the Grand Prix, which I am incredibly happy about and I hope that prestigious film festivals await me in the future.
